In order to straighten out pronunciation in the case of "j/q/x + u", we need to first look at basic spelling rules in Pinyin. There are two distinct vowel sounds in Mandarin, spelt "u" and "ü".
WebWhen you make the "x-" sound, make sure that the tip of your tongue is down, behind your lower front teeth (and same position for pinyin "q-" and "j-"), and that you can smile as you make it Whenever you see the vowel "u" after an "x-", "q-", or "j-", it is actually the "ü" vowel in disguise Review the "Gotchas" WebHow to pronounce Xuefeng? When you want to introduce yourself to Chinese speakers, the most natural way to say your name in Chinese is to start with 我叫 (Wǒ jiào) and then follow it up with your name. In this sentence, 我 (wǒ) is the personal pronoun “I”, and 叫 (jiào) is a versatile verb, meaning “be called” here. small black clothing rackWebDec 15, 2024 · Pronunciation of Xun with 2 audio pronunciations 6 ratings 0 rating Record the pronunciation of this word in your own voice and play it to listen to how you have pronounced it.
